Metamaterial composed of artificial periodic structure is applied to a wireless power transfer system to enhance the efficiency of long distance power transfer. Metamaterial can control the direction of magnetic fields due to its negative permeability. Previously reported metamaterials were too thick and large in size to increase the power transfer distance. A highly efficient wireless power transfer using a metamaterial slab with a zero refractive property is proposed. The proposed metamaterial slab consists of a spiral structure, a lumped element and a via through the ground.
